On Display - Damage Main Store, Arrival Fountain


As I've been "trapped' on many locations since my return to Second Life, I've discovered that statue locations range from mediocre placements to outstandingly beautiful scenes.  One of the best locations is at a store called "Damage", which not only sells clothes, but has plenty of locations which allows you to pose!



This particular location has fast become one of my favorites, as Damage offers a number of unique things other statue fountains/plinths don't offer.  First, the design is well done.  The fountain is build nicely (even has a script to allow a passerby to "make a wish" - a nice touch!), textured well, and the water flows beautifully.  Speaking of the water, it actually "flows", at first "surrounding" you, then slowly recedes to just below your feet.



Next, the skin provided for display is very well done.  The skin package is called "Damage Mossy Stone", which includes a nice "mossy stone" pony tail, stone eyes, and a nicely done "mossy stone" skin - the texture has no waste problems (some have a broken patter - not very aesthetic)!  Though the above photo is a distance shot of my rear, you can see how the skin has nice contunity.


Nice use of textures to contrast between the build and the ground & water flow animation
(nice attention to detail!)

As a statue, one likes to be on display, and here you are at the entrance to a major store, so on "display" you are!  Good traffic, but you are simply seen as part of the scenery (which is the point)!  Finally, some fountains have a RLV trap to keep one in place ... but Mr. Carmichael is a tad more clever!  If you join his model group, you'll be compensated a Linden per half hour you are in place.  Not a fortune, mind you, but it is a small appreciation for something that the readers of this blog enjoy doing for free.


This is one of the best "statue" locations in SL - nice environment, well designed and executed build / skins, and high traffic... and as such, its usually very busy, so if you are lucky enough to hop on this fountain, do so with all speed!  To visit, please follow this SLurl to Damage's Main Store... http://slurl.com/secondlife/threlkeld/190/189/43/
